PHP echo and print Statements. echo and print are more or less the same. They are both used to output data to the screen. The differences are small: echo has no return value while print has a return value of 1 so it can be used in expressions. echo can take multiple parameters (although such usage is rare) while print can take one argument ... . Oct 8, 2021 · MySQL is an open-source relational database management system (RDBMS). It is the most popular database system used with PHP. MySQL is developed, distributed, and supported by Oracle Corporation. The data in a MySQL database are stored in tables which consists of columns and rows. PHP User Defined Functions. Besides the built-in PHP functions, it is possible to create your own functions. A function is a block of statements that can be used repeatedly in a program. Aug 1, 2023 · Now PHP supports data: protocol w/out "//" like data:text/plain, not data://text/plain, I tried it. +add a note PHP Output Control Functions. PHP provides a set of functions that control what content is sent to the browser and when. This is referred to as output control. PHP and the backend on which it is running may hold the output in a buffer before sending it to the user. Note: The output control functions can create any number of output buffers. Abstract classes and methods are when the parent class has a named method, but need its child class (es) to fill out the tasks. An abstract class is a class that contains at least one abstract method. An abstract method is a method that is declared, but not implemented in the code. The PHP $_REQUEST variable contains the contents of both $_GET, $_POST, and $_COOKIE. We will discuss $_COOKIE variable when we will explain about cookies. The PHP $_REQUEST variable can be used to get the result from form data sent with both the GET and POST methods. Try out following example by putting the source code in test.php script. PHP Check End-Of-File - feof() The feof() function checks if the "end-of-file" (EOF) has been reached. The feof() function is useful for looping through data of unknown length. Dec 1, 2019 · Instead, the form data or request for the web page gets sent to a web server to be processed by the PHP scripts. The web server then sends the processed HTML back to you (which is where 'Hypertext Preprocessor' in the name comes from), and your web browser displays the results. In PHP, as in all programming languages, data types are used to classify one particular type of data. This is important because the specific data type you use will determine what values you can assign to it and what you can do to it (including what operations you can perform on it).
